Zhenmin Cheng is a scholar working on Catalysis, Mechanical Engineering and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Zhenmin Cheng has authored 22 papers receiving a total of 553 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Catalysis, 7 papers in Mechanical Engineering and 7 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Zhenmin Cheng's work include Ionic liquids properties and applications (7 papers), CO2 Reduction Techniques and Catalysts (7 papers) and Catalytic Processes in Materials Science (4 papers). Zhenmin Cheng is often cited by papers focused on Ionic liquids properties and applications (7 papers), CO2 Reduction Techniques and Catalysts (7 papers) and Catalytic Processes in Materials Science (4 papers). Zhenmin Cheng collaborates with scholars based in China, Saudi Arabia and Yemen. Zhenmin Cheng's co-authors include Chengzhen Chen, Bo Zhang, Zhiming Zhou, Fanghua Zhang, Hongjie Cui, Fahim A. Qaraah, Weikang Yuan, Samah A. Mahyoub, Yuanjie Pang and Pei‐Qing Yuan and has published in prestigious journals such as Chemical Engineering Journal, Journal of Materials Chemistry A and Chemosphere.
